AWS Shield is a managed DDoS protection service designed to safeguard your web applications running on AWS. Whether you're handling transactional traffic, sensitive data, or critical customer-facing services, AWS Shield provides the resilience and uptime needed to scale securely.

Always-On DDoS Protection

We configure AWS Shield Standard and Advanced to continuously monitor and auto-mitigate volumetric attacks across all AWS endpoints.

Integration with Route 53 & WAF

We link Shield with AWS WAF and Route 53 for intelligent routing, geofencing, and rule-based blocking of suspicious patterns.

Real-Time Attack Diagnostics and Alerts

We activate detailed logging via CloudWatch and SNS to instantly alert your team and provide full visibility into attack vectors.

Automated Layer 3, 4 & 7 Mitigation

We implement protections against network, transport, and application-layer attacks with customizable thresholds and rate-based rules.

Global Threat Intelligence Access

With Shield Advanced, we provide access to AWS’s DDoS Response Team (DRT) and global threat insights for high-risk application defense.

Cost Protection and SLA Commitments

We configure billing safeguards and work with AWS support to ensure credits and service guarantees in case of prolonged or large-scale DDoS events.
